Main Duties / Responsibilities- Clinical/Technical Investigations including generation of accurate reports.
- Flow volume loop.
- Reversibility testing administration of bronchodilator drugs.
- Gas transfer test.
- Body Plethysmography/Nitrogen Washout.
- Feno testing.
- Pulse oximetry.
- Six Minute Walk test.
- Skin prick allergy testing (Royal Cornwall Hospital site).
- Respiratory muscle testing (MIP, MEP and SNIP).
- Hypoxic challenge tests.
Main duties of the job- Equipment Maintenance.
- Responsible for appropriate use, upkeep, and maintenance of highly specialised equipment.
- Lung Function Equipment.
- Calibrate and clean daily.
- Disconnect and reconnect compressed gas cylinders as required.
- Undertake routine maintenance and troubleshooting, fault finding on complex equipment to maintain service delivery.
- If problems arise that cannot be solved contact the manufacturer for advice or to request call out.
- Monitor stock levels of disposables/chemicals.
- Undertake physiological check on equipment on a weekly basis.
About usRoyal Cornwall Hospitals NHS Trust (RCHT) is at the heart of acute and specialist care for Cornwall and the Isles of Scilly. We care for a population of around 470,000 people, a number that rises significantly during peak visitor seasons. We employ around 6,700 staff, united by a shared commitment to deliver safe, high-quality care. We provide services across three main hospital sites, with around 780 inpatient beds:
- Royal Cornwall Hospital in Truro
- St Michael's Hospital in Hayle
- West Cornwall Hospital in Penzance
As a teaching hospital, we are proud to work in partnership with the University of Exeter Medical School, the University of Plymouth School of Nursing and Midwifery, and Peninsula Dental School, supporting the next generation of health professionals while continually strengthening our own services.
